TE Connectivity AMP Connectors 87543-8 Equivalent & Substitute Parts

Part Overview

The TE Connectivity AMP Connectors 87543-8 is a rectangular connector header designed for through-hole mounting applications. This connector is a vertical 16-position header with 2.54mm (0.100") pitch spacing, configured in a 2-row layout for board-to-board or cable interconnection. The part operates as an unshrouded, push-pull fastened connector with solder termination.

The 87543-8 carries an obsolete product status, which necessitates identification of equivalent substitute components for ongoing design support and procurement. Active equivalent parts are available to maintain design continuity and ensure component availability for production and field service applications.

Engineering Selection Recommendations

The substitute part 5-87543-8 is the direct equivalent for the obsolete 87543-8. Both components share identical mechanical and electrical specifications across all critical parameters including connector architecture, contact configuration, pitch spacing, and termination methodology.

The primary distinction between the two parts is product status and regulatory compliance. The 87543-8 is classified as obsolete and carries RoHS non-compliant status. The 5-87543-8 maintains active product status and achieves RoHS compliance through substitution of the contact finish specification from Tin-Lead to Tin on both mating and post surfaces. This contact finish modification does not alter the electrical or mechanical performance characteristics of the connector.

For new designs and ongoing production applications, the 5-87543-8 is the appropriate selection. For legacy system support where the original Tin-Lead finish is specifically required, the 87543-8 remains available in current inventory. The contact finish change from Tin-Lead to Tin represents a standard industry transition for RoHS compliance and does not introduce compatibility issues with standard mating connectors or PCB assembly processes.

Frequently Asked Questions (FAQ)

Q: Can the 5-87543-8 directly replace the 87543-8 in existing designs?

A: Yes. The 5-87543-8 is mechanically and electrically equivalent to the 87543-8. Both components feature identical 16-position, 2-row header configuration with 0.100" (2.54mm) pitch spacing, through-hole solder termination, and push-pull fastening. The contact finish change from Tin-Lead to Tin does not affect connector performance or mating compatibility.

Q: What is the difference between the Tin-Lead finish on the 87543-8 and the Tin finish on the 5-87543-8?

A: The 87543-8 uses Tin-Lead contact plating, while the 5-87543-8 uses Tin contact plating. Both finishes provide equivalent electrical conductivity and contact reliability. The Tin finish on the 5-87543-8 enables RoHS compliance. The finish thickness remains constant at 100.0µin (2.54µm) on both parts.

Q: Why is the 87543-8 marked as obsolete?

A: The 87543-8 carries obsolete status due to its RoHS non-compliant Tin-Lead contact finish. The 5-87543-8 represents the active production equivalent with RoHS-compliant Tin finish. TE Connectivity maintains the 87543-8 in inventory for legacy system support.

Q: Are there packaging differences between the 87543-8 and 5-87543-8?

A: The 87543-8 is supplied in standard packaging, while the 5-87543-8 is supplied in Bulk packaging. This packaging distinction does not affect component functionality or performance. Selection between packaging options depends on procurement and inventory management requirements.

Q: What is the Moisture Sensitivity Level (MSL) for these connectors?

A: Both the 87543-8 and 5-87543-8 carry MSL 1 (Unlimited) classification. This indicates unlimited shelf life without moisture control requirements, making these components suitable for standard storage and handling conditions.

Q: Are these connectors suitable for board-to-board and cable applications?

A: Yes. Both the 87543-8 and 5-87543-8 are classified as Board to Board or Cable style connectors. The unshrouded header design with male pin contacts accommodates both application types.

Q: What is the through-hole post length for PCB mounting?

A: The contact post length is 0.125" (3.18mm) on both the 87543-8 and 5-87543-8. This dimension specifies the length of the pin extending below the insulation body for through-hole PCB insertion and solder termination.
